Output 63b574e84962ba30fa6cc5ea2de5dd7e45bc2d9227a810264ad9ee3385aa2a68:90

value
42950
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 355db5452f60d47fab2a960e632c470df841799bfedac796ffd4dd861d1e6c39
address
bc1px4wm23f0vr28l2e2jc8xxtz8phuyz7vmlmdv09hl6nwcv8g7dsus4742w3
transaction
63b574e84962ba30fa6cc5ea2de5dd7e45bc2d9227a810264ad9ee3385aa2a68
confirmations
130881
spent
true